Ali Fedotowsky-Manno’s husband, Kevin Manno, was diagnosed with a form of thyroid cancer.
The “Bachelorette” star In addition to her husband, it appeared in a video shared on Instagram, where they not only discussed his diagnosis, but also encouraged fans to divide their own experiences with thyroid cancer.
Manno, a radio and TV -guest lord, revealed that he was diagnosed with papillary thyroid cancer after doctors had found two “malignant places on his right side”, in addition to possible cancer in a lymph node.
“We recently discovered that @kevinmanno has papillaire thyroid cancer. Fortunately it is a very treatable cancer,” she subtitled a video. “He has 2 malignant places on his right side and it seems that it is also in one lymph node, but we will not know for sure until his operation.”

Fedotowsky-Manno, 40, found for the first time as a participant in season 14 of “The Bachelor”, before he returned a year later as the star of season six of the popular dating competition series “The Bachelorette.”

While her engagement with “The Bachelorette” Winner Roberto Martinez is not long -lasting, she later found love in the arms of radio and TV host Kevin Manno. The couple married in March 2017 and has two children.
